Tradewind are currently recruiting for a qualified Primary Teacher to work at an Outstanding Primary school in Islington, who are in the process of opening a provision for SEN students with SEMH. The role is full time and long term from November, for the full academic year until July 2021 and will most likely become permanent for the right candidate.



The school is an Outstanding Ofsted rated mainstream school in Islington providing for students aged 6-11. They are currently opening a provision to support students struggling with Social, Emotional and Mental Health difficulties (SEMH) and challenging behaviour.



The role is to teach a class with a maximum of 8 students in Key Stage 1 and Key Stage 2. There are multiple years in one class from Year 2 - 4 and all students have SEMH with behavioural needs, so the successful teacher will need to have strong behaviour management skills and experience. Teaching Assistants will be supporting within the class to help students engage in lessons and to manage any behavioural issues to ensure lessons run smoothly and students make progress.

The school are ideally looking for a qualified teacher with experience teaching in UK schools, strong behavioural management and a good command of written and spoken English and literacy skills.
